#Method static constexpr SkIPoint16 Make(int x, int y)

#Line # constructs from integer inputs ##
Sets fX to x, fY to y. If SK_DEBUG is defined, asserts
if x or y does not fit in 16 bits.

#Param x  integer x-axis value of constructed IPoint ##
#Param y  integer y-axis value of constructed IPoint ##

#Return IPoint16 (x, y) ##

#Example
SkIPoint16 pt1 = {45, 66};
SkIPoint16 pt2 = SkIPoint16::Make(45, 66);
SkDebugf("pt1.fX %c= pt2.fX\n", pt1.fX == pt2.fX ? '=' : '!');
SkDebugf("pt1.fY %c= pt2.fY\n", pt1.fY == pt2.fY ? '=' : '!');
#StdOut
pt1.fX == pt2.fX
pt1.fY == pt2.fY
##
##

#SeeAlso set() SkPoint::iset() SkIPoint::Make
